How do single-acting and double-acting solenoid valves work?

2016-02-01View Original

Thread Content

In compressed air pipelines, solenoid valves are often used for control. Solenoid valves generally come in single-acting and double-acting types. Could someone explain the principles behind each type as well as their typical applications? Thank you
Reply #22016-02-01
This post was last edited by ylb913 on 2016-2-1 at 12:56. A single-acting cylinder is actuated by air on one side and returned to its original position by a spring on the other side. A double-acting cylinder is actuated on both sides by air; there are no springs inside the cylinder. A single-acting solenoid valve is reset by a spring on one side while being actuated by electromagnetic force on the other side; a double-acting solenoid valve is actuated by electromagnetic force on both sides.

First of all, the terms \"single-acting\" and \"double-acting\" refer to pneumatic valves; the pilot solenoids used with them correspond to two-position three-way solenoids and two-position five-way solenoids. Pilot solenoids are generally single-coil, while those with double coils are known as three-position five-way solenoids. Pilot solenoids can be used independently or as part of a valve island setup. A single-acting cylinder has a spring on one side of it, which allows it to close on its own. Double-acting cylinders do not have springs.
